password-encryption相关内容
我使用带有bcrypt密码编码器的Spring security进行身份验证。当我想登录时,Spring安全会使用JPA正确获取用户数据,但为了检查原始密码和编码密码,它会将空字符串作为编码密码提供给密码编码器。 Spring安全配置: @Configuration public class SecurityConfig extends WebSecurityConfigurerAda
..
我目前正在使用 Java 创建应用程序,我在谷歌上搜索了 Java 密码加密,但结果如此巨大,我感到不知所措.如何使用 Java 加密和解密密码?加密和解密密码的最佳实践是什么?我猜 MD5 不是一种方法,因为它是一种单向哈希.我使用 struts2 作为我的框架,想知道他们是否提供密码加密 解决方案 更新: 试试 JBCrypt: 字符串密码 = "MyPassword123";
..
我找到了在 Java 中实现 AES 加密/解密的指南,并在我将其放入自己的解决方案时尝试理解每一行.但是,我并不完全理解它,因此遇到了问题.最终目标是拥有基于密码的加密/解密.我已阅读有关此的其他文章/stackoverflow 帖子,但大多数都没有提供足够的解释(我对 Java 中的加密非常陌生) 我现在的主要问题是即使我设置了 byte[] saltBytes = "Hello".ge
..
我正在为学校申请,在将密码插入我的用户数据库时,我需要帮助加密密码.我正在使用 c# 编程语言进行编程,我正在使用 MS server 2008 R2 来操作我的数据库.我正在考虑进行 HASH 加密,如果有人帮助我,我会很高兴. 这是我将数据插入数据库的代码: using (SqlConnection con = new SqlConnection("Data Source=HRC0;I
..
我有一个包含通过 cfusion_encrypt() 加密的用户密码的数据库.我需要为 C# 中的 ColdFusion 代码做一个登录替代.有没有什么简单的方法可以在 C# 中模拟这一点,以便我能够比较用户密码的加密值并将它们与 ColdFusion 值匹配? 解决方案 名字不好的cfusion_encrypt()不是加密.它是一种内部的遗留混淆算法,强烈建议不要使用它. 基本上它
..
例如命令: openssl enc -aes-256-cbc -a -in test.txt -k pinkrhino -nosalt -p -out openssl_output.txt 输出类似: key = 33D890D33F91D52FC9B405A0DDA65336C3C4B557A3D79FE69AB674BE82C5C3D2iv = 677C95C475C0E057B7397
..
我找到了一份在 Java 中实现 AES 加密/解密的指南,并试图理解每一行,因为我将其放入我自己的解决方案中.但是,我并不完全理解它,因此遇到了问题.最终目标是拥有基于密码的加密/解密.我已经阅读了关于此的其他文章/stackoverflow 帖子,但大多数都没有提供足够的解释(我对 Java 中的加密非常陌生) 我现在的主要问题是即使我设置了 byte[] saltBytes = "He
..
又一个晚上,另一个问题! 我创建了一个登录页面,如果密码是纯文本,它就可以正常工作. 我遇到的问题是我的注册表单使用 password_hash 将加密的密码输入到表中. 我当前的脚本如下. 注册脚本 $password = password_hash($_POST['password'], PASSWORD_DEFAULT); 登录脚本 setAttribute(P
..
我使用的是 Python 3我有一个用户名映射到密码的 Auth_INI ConfigParser 文件.我需要加密密码用密码这样只有密码才能解密它. >Auth_INI = ConfigParser()>密码 = '密码'>密码加密 = 加密(密码,'密码')>Auth_INI['用户名'] = password_encrypted 它所需要的可能只是某种困难的散列/非散列编码.我不需要任何
..
如果我理解正确,任何 PHP 升级或移动到不同的服务器都会使以前散列的密码(存储在数据库中)变得无用?因为盐在新系统上会有所不同. 这让我对自动生成盐的用例感到好奇. 解决方案 password_hash() 现在(从 PHP 7.1.* 开始)只使用 bcrypt 来散列密码.Salt 与散列一起保存,因此升级或移动到另一台服务器不会使散列无用. 正如 @Jay Blanch
..
我使用 Visual Studio 2015 企业版创建了一个面向 .Net Framework 4.5.2 的简单 C# 类库,其中一个类. 示例代码: namespace PwdEncryptor{公开课 Class1{公共字符串加密(字符串实际密码){返回 String.Concat(actualPassword, "Encrypt");}}} 我想在另一个系统上使用我的power
..
我使用 Powershell 已经有一段时间了,但我不明白加密是如何工作的,甚至不确定我在阅读帮助文件时使用了正确的语法. #获取用户信息$User = Read-Host "请输入您的用户名"$Password = Read-Host "请输入您的密码.这将被加密" -AsSecureString |ConvertTo-SecureString -AsPlainText -Force#定义一个
..
我正在努力学习一些处理密码的好习惯.我将提供我的项目中的一些代码片段,并解释我担心和好奇的事情. 让我们从获取用户输入的代码开始,我的按钮事件代码: string username = txtUser.Text;字符串密码 = Hash.EncryptString(txtPass.Text); 我的想法是,将密码以明文形式存储在字符串中可能是不好的做法?我知道这可能不是解决方案(特别是因
..
我在 Spring MVC 上开发了一个小项目.该项目有帐户表,帐户有一个使用 BCryptPasswordEncoder 编码的密码.我使用了 java 配置而不是 XML 配置. @Configuration@启用网络安全公共类 SecurityConfiguration 扩展了 WebSecurityConfigurerAdapter@豆角,扁豆public PasswordEncoder
..
我使用 Jasypt API(版本 1.9.2)进行加密和解密.在使用命令行界面工具列出算法时,我得到以下列表. listAlgorithms.batPBE 算法:[PBEWITHHMACSHA1ANDAES_128,PBEWITHHMACSHA1ANDAES_256,PBEWITHHMACSHA224ANDAES_128,PBEWITHHMACSHA224ANDAES_256,PBEWITHH
..
所以基本上我想编写一个 Powershell 脚本,它将导出过去 1 天的 Windows Server Backup 备份日志,将信息格式化为一个漂亮的小表,然后 SMTP 将其发送到客户本地 Exchange 之外的外部位置.我有一个可以用于此目的的智能主机,以及凭据等. 但我不想将 UN 和密码以纯文本形式存储在 Powershell 中,也不想使用纯文本形式的凭据运行脚本. 有
..
所以我知道您可以使用基于 userDetail 属性的 salt 在 Spring Security 中检查密码,然后将其散列以与数据库中的散列进行比较,但是如果创建每个用户时使用的 salt 是随机的(并且是存储在数据库中),我是否需要创建自己的包含 salt 属性的 userDetails 类,然后将其设置为 spring security 用于在 securityApplicationCon
..
我正在制作一个网站,我试图在其中创建一个表单,该表单将用户输入发送到我的谷歌文档/驱动器中的谷歌电子表格...我发现了一个 Github 项目,可以让人们对 php 进行编码...它包括脚本所需的其他 2 个 php 文件.代码如下: 我的问题是,如何在 $u =/$p = 下的脚本中隐藏我的密码?查看代码的任何人都可以看到我的密码..我该如何防止? 脚本来源的链接是:http://w
..
我想使用 maven 密码加密. 我做到了: mvn --encrypt-master-password 12345 好的.我在括号内得到了一个加密密码.然后: mvn --encrypt-password 12345 Maven 抱怨: [ERROR] 执行 Maven 时出错.[错误] java.io.FileNotFoundException:/home/myUserName
..
我目前正在学习 PHP,我一直在浏览论坛,了解如何最好地在 PHP 中散列密码. 任何人都可以就目前使用的最佳密码散列方法提供建议.我听说过 PHPass,但 2017 年有更好的选择吗? 感谢您的建议, 伊恩 解决方案 你不应该加密密码,你应该只对它们进行哈希处理.加密意味着您可以将密码解密为人类可读的形式.你永远不应该那样做.散列是一种单向方式,一旦散列,密码就无法以
..